A liquid filter vessel acts as a barrier designed to remove impurities from liquids in various industrial processes. It is engineered to enhance fluid purity by capturing contaminants such as sediments, debris, and other particulates. The engineering behind liquid filter vessels involves cutting-edge technology and materials, which provide superior filtration performance and reliability. With precision design, these vessels cater to specific industry needs, ranging from microfiltration to ultrafiltration. Industries such as pharmaceuticals, chemicals, food and beverage, and water treatment rely heavily on liquid filter vessels to maintain stringent hygiene and quality standards. In pharmaceutical production, for instance, achieving a high level of liquid purity is paramount. The filter vessels remove unwanted particles, ensuring the final product's safety and efficacy. Chemical industries benefit from these vessels by maintaining process integrity and minimizing contamination risk, ultimately preserving product quality and operational efficiency.

One of the hallmark features of a liquid filter vessel is its adaptability. These vessels can be customized to meet unique industrial requirements, offering a range of dimensions, pressure capabilities, and filtration efficiencies. This adaptability ensures that industries can optimize their processes without compromising on performance or quality. For example, liquid filter vessels can be tailored to operate under high-pressure environments, making them ideal for applications in demanding industrial conditions. The operational benefits of using a liquid filter vessel are multi-faceted. Firstly, these vessels contribute significantly to reducing operational downtime. By preventing clogging and ensuring continuous product flow, they enhance productivity and lower maintenance costs. Secondly, they offer an economical solution for fluid processing, as their robust design and ease of maintenance extend the life cycle of the filtration system.liquid filter vessel
Another crucial advantage of liquid filter vessels is their environmental impact. Companies are increasingly opting for eco-friendly practices, and effective filtration systems play a vital role in this transition. By efficiently removing harmful particulates before waste discharge, these vessels help meet regulatory standards and reduce the environmental footprint of their operations.
